Democratic New York Attorney General Letitia James was caught on camera "smirking" broadly as Donald Trump Jr. prepared to testify on behalf of the defense in the Trump civil fraud trial on Monday, Fox News reported.

James has been a near-constant presence in the Manhattan courtroom over the past month as she attempts to financially cripple and destroy former President Donald Trump's business empire with a $250 million civil fraud lawsuit -- something she specifically campaigned for office on doing.

The attorney general has accused Trump, his two adult sons, and the Trump Organization of unlawfully inflating and manipulating claimed asset values and Trump's own reported net worth in financial statements in order to obtain better terms for bank loans and insurance coverage.

James caught on camera

The ongoing civil fraud trial itself has not been televised but pool reporters with cameras have been let in the courtroom ahead of the proceedings, which led to the capture of a rather stark and revelatory moment on Monday, according to Newsweek.

As Don Jr. prepared to take the stand in his father's defense, CNN aired footage that showed him looking serious and intent, which was immediately juxtaposed with AG James seated just a few rows back "smirking" and clearly enjoying herself.

Newsweek noted that AG James' office declined to respond to a request for comment about her "facial expressions and demeanor" that were caught on camera by a pool reporter.

That didn't stop social media users from providing plenty of commentary on the footage, however, both in support of and in opposition to the attorney general who vowed to target and persecute the former president and his eponymous family business while running for office.
